ICC prosecutors say Libyan suspect was notorious torturer
THE HAGUE, May 19 - A 47-year-old suspect accused of overseeing one of the most notorious prisons in Libya was known as a ruthless torturer nicknamed \"the angel of death\" by detainees, prosecutors told judges at the International Criminal Court on Tuesday.
